Facility detail
11355 ARROW RTE, RANCHO CUCAMONGA, CA, 91730
Parent company: STANLEY WORKS
Reported on-site TRI releases in pounds (lbs), grouped by reporting year.
The 10 chemicals with the highest cumulative on-site releases in pounds (lbs) across all available years.
Rows are years. Columns show the five highest-total chemicals across all years plus each year's total release volume.
| All values in pounds (lbs) | ||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Year | 1,1,1-Trichloroethane | Acetone | n-Butyl alcohol | Total (lbs) | ||
| 1993 | 202,107 | — | — | 202,107 | ||
| 1992 | 308,759 | — | — | 308,759 | ||
| 1991 | 357,260 | 28,218 | — | 385,478 | ||
| 1990 | 203,841 | 20,769 | — | 224,610 | ||
| 1989 | 59,866 | 9,240 | 1,138 | 70,244 | ||
| 1988 | — | 64,895 | — | 64,895 | ||
